The EMEA Retail & Central Europe Marketing Manager is responsible for conceiving and coordinating 360° marketing activities for the Central Europe (German, BeNeLux and CH) markets. Design, develop, and implement programs to promote the organisation’s products, brands, and services through events, media, and sales and press. The candidate is also responsible for developing EMEA retail marketing strategies that drive foot traffic, sales leads, and enhance the in-store experience for dealers and retailers. This role requires strategic thinking, creative execution, and strong communication skills to promote the organization's offerings and maintain positive media relations.

  • Accountable in building and executing the marketing plan for Central Europe to support the growth objectives for the territory, in alignment with the Country Managers and coordination with the sales force on the field.
  • Manages the marketing budgets for Central Europe. Manages the promo fund budget and follows up on expenses.
  • Responsible for developing cross-EMEA marketing strategies that drive foot traffic, generate sales leads, and enhance the in-store experience for dealers and retailers. This involves creating and directing strategies that are implemented across the entire EMEA region to ensure consistency and effectiveness in marketing efforts.
  • Develops and implements brand-specific strategies and concrete actions to drive lead and sales generation for Central Europe.
  • Accountable for the end-to-end event organisation for Central Europe (boat shows, dealer meetings, end users testing days…), targeted marketing communication, design, use of marketing and boat show material, transport and budget follow-up
  • Partner with the dealer network to enhance their POS, websites and (social) media presence by developing creative, clearly written materials by editorial and style guidelines.
  • The Marketing Manager oversees the brand's social media pages, creating engaging content that attracts attention and encourages followers to interact with the brand. 
  • Develops strategies for social influencers, builds relationships with pro-anglers, and creates engaging social media content while maintaining connections with bloggers and the online community.
  • Identifies target groups and determines the communication strategy.
  • Has content ownership for the b2b and b2c communication through the systems used by the company, using MercuryMarine.com as the company's main website.
  • Accountable for coordinating the translation work for Central Europe and proofreading for marketing media.
  • Coordinates the production/distribution to sales channel of POS material such as multimedia packages, posters, manuals, fliers, catalogues, and banners, in line with the marketing communication plan
  • Actively participates in international projects across EMEA
  • Uses specific marketing strategies and media to support the new product launch in Central Europe in alignment with the EMEA new product introduction plan.
  • They track the latest model offerings of relevant product lines and provide dealers, OEMs, and retail partners with product information and marketing material.
  • As the point of contact for the press in Central Europe, the Marketing Manager is responsible for building strong relationships with press contacts, coordinating translation and communication of press releases, and organizing product tests.

This exciting position is a Global Grade 12 and offers a salary of between €64,500 and €80,000 (payable in 13.92 instalments). Please be aware that this range represents the pay range for all positions within the job grade in which the post falls. The actual salary offer will consider a wide range of factors, including skills, experience, and location (country). We also offer the following benefits:  
  • A Bonus Plan with a target of 8% of the annual salary;
  • Meal vouchers with a face value of 8€;
  • 5 extra-legal vacation days (“congés conventionnels”);
  • Group Pension, Disability Plan & Hospitalization Insurance;
  • Possibility to do homeworking;
  • Free access to LinkedIn Learning for your personal development;
